Daily Job Functions


  • Enforces the provisions of all city ordinances, laws and regulations; initiates action necessary to correct violations; issues warning notices and/or citations
  • Works to increase live release rates through partnerships with rescue organizations, reunification, foster and adoptions.
  • Coordinates daily work activities; schedules, assigns, and monitors department operations.
  • Maintains knowledge and awareness of laws/regulations, procedures, trends and advances in the profession.
  • Euthanizes sick, injured, dangerous, wild or unwanted animals.
  • Impounds stray, sick, diseased, wild, rabid, dangerous, dead, injured animals and livestock.
  • Provides guidance, assistance, and training to animal control officers and shelter attendants.
  • Communicates with supervisor, city employees, other animal control agencies, veterinarians, local businesses, and the public as needed to coordinate work activities, review status of work, exchange information, or resolves problems
  • Remains available for on call emergency response to aggressive, sick, or injured animals, bite cases, loose livestock and wild animals in the home.
  • Monitors status of work and evaluates completed work.


The ideal candidate will have the minimum qualifications, experience and certifications:


  • Requires four years animal welfare or closely related experience.
  • National Animal Control Level 1, 2, and 3 (or State equivalent)
  • Requires an Associate's Degree or specialized courses/training equivalent to satisfactory completion of two years of college
  • Certified Euthanasia Technician
  • Certified Animal Control Officer
  • National Animal Control Cruelty Level 1 and 2 (or State equivalent)
